Happy Valentines Day or in other words Single Awareness Day according to Charlamagne. Moreover, we had wide receiver Antonio Brown stop by for the first time where he spoke about all the controversy surrounding him, and even promoted a new song hes rapping on. Also, we had reformed bully 50 cent stop by where he spoke about French Montana, Power and more. Also, Charlamagne definitely got some people in their feelings after he gave the single people "Donkey of the Day" today
